1 Big Thing: Stress is a common experience, affecting millions worldwide. It's not just a feeling of being overwhelmed; it's a physical and mental response that can impact your health significantly.

Why It Matters: Long-term stress can lead to a host of health problems, including heart disease, diabetes, depression, and anxiety. Understanding and managing stress is vital for maintaining both physical and mental health.

Between the Lines: While stress is inevitable, there are many effective ways to manage it. The key is identifying stressors and adopting strategies that work for you to mitigate its impact.

Understanding Stress

Stress is the body's reaction to any change that requires an adjustment or response. It can be triggered by both good and bad experiences. When faced with a challenge, the body responds physically, mentally, and emotionally.

Types of Stress:

  • Acute Stress: This is the most common type and comes from demands and pressures of the recent past and anticipated demands and pressures of the near future.
  • Episodic Acute Stress: This is frequent acute stress, often experienced by people with chaotic lives or those who are always in a rush.
  • Chronic Stress: This is the grinding stress that wears people away day after day, year after year.

Signs of Stress

  • Emotional symptoms like moodiness, irritability, or feeling overwhelmed
  • Physical symptoms such as headaches, muscle tension, or sleep disturbances
  • Cognitive symptoms including constant worrying or racing thoughts

Stress Management Techniques

  1. Identify Stressors: Recognize the primary sources of stress in your life. Is it work, family, health, finances, or something else?
  2. Healthy Lifestyle Choices: Regular exercise, a balanced diet, and adequate sleep can significantly reduce stress levels.
  3. Mindfulness and Relaxation Techniques: Practices like meditation, deep breathing, and yoga can help calm your mind and reduce stress.
  4. Time Management: Organizing your time effectively can help manage stress. Prioritize tasks and break down large tasks into smaller, manageable ones.
  5. Social Support: Talking to friends, family, or a professional can provide emotional support and help you manage stress.
  6. Avoid Unnecessary Stress: Learn to say 'no' to additional responsibilities when you're already stretched thin.
  7. Change Your Perspective: Try to view stressful situations from a more positive perspective.

When to Seek Professional Help

If stress becomes overwhelming, and you're struggling to cope, it's crucial to seek professional help. Persistent and unmanageable stress can lead to serious health issues.
